一条sql实现根据某个字段的去重操作 10
2016-06-23
展开全部
如果去重复就是distinct,你要去除重复记录,用distinct,在用group by试试
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
distinct函数
更多追问追答
追问
现在不是要查询,就是要清理数据库,物理删除,而且只能用一天sql语句,不能用函数和存储过程
追答
先安装某个字段group by分组,取出一个id(这里用max)保证不同的字段一定有一个唯一的主键id,然后再删除 not in这些主键的数据。
delete from
table
where rowid not in (
select max(id)
from table
group by 某个字段
)
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询